Abstract: In general, techniques are described for performing residual prediction in video coding. As one example, a device configured to code scalable or multi-view video data may comprise one or more processors configured to perform the techniques. The processors may determine a difference picture, for a current picture, based on a first reference picture in a same layer or view as the current picture and a decoded picture in a different layer or view as the current picture. The decoded picture may be in a same access unit as the first reference picture. The processors may perform bi-prediction based on the difference picture to code at least a portion of the current picture.

Abstract: A method for motion estimation for screen and non-natural content coding is disclosed. In one aspect, the method may include selecting a candidate block of a first frame of the video data for matching with a current block of a second frame of the video data, calculating a first partial matching cost for matching a first subset of samples of the candidate block to the current block, and determining whether the candidate block has a lowest matching cost with the current block based at least in part on the first partial matching cost.

Abstract: In one example, a method of coding video data includes coding, from an encoded video bitstream, a syntax element that indicates a number of lines of video data that are in one or more of a plurality of sub-PUs of a current prediction unit (PU) of a current coding unit (CU) of video data. In this example, the method further includes determining, for each respective sub-PU of the plurality of sub-PUs, a respective vector that represents a displacement between the respective sub-PU and a respective predictor block from a plurality of previously decoded blocks of video data. In this example, the method further includes reconstructing each sub-PU of the plurality of sub-PUs based on the respective predictor blocks of video data.

Abstract: An apparatus configured to code video information comprises a memory unit and a processor in communication with the memory unit. The memory unit is configured to store video information associated with a reference layer (RL) and an enhancement layer (EL). The EL comprises an EL video unit and the RL comprises an RL video unit corresponding to the EL video unit. The processor is configured to perform upsampling and bit-depth conversion on pixel information of the RL video unit in a single combined process to determine predicted pixel information of the EL video unit, and determine the EL video unit using the predicted pixel information.

Abstract: A method of coding video data includes receiving one or more layers of video information. Each layer may include at least one picture. The method can include processing an indicator within at least one of a video parameter set (VPS), a sequence parameter set (SPS), or a picture parameter set (PPS) that indicates whether all direct reference layer pictures associated with the at least one of the video parameter set (VPS), the sequence parameter set (SPS), or the picture parameter set (PPS) are added to an inter-layer reference picture set. Based on the indicator, the method can further include refraining from further signaling inter-layer reference picture information in any video slice associated with the at least one of the video parameter set (VPS), the sequence parameter set (SPS), or the picture parameter set (PPS). Alternatively, based on the indicator, the method can further include adding to the inter-layer reference picture set all direct reference layer pictures for any video slice associated with the at least one of the video parameter set (VPS), the sequence parameter set (SPS), or the picture parameter set (PPS).
